    broken trailing edge wire
    I put some new rib extensions on and just before I was ready to start the fabric I decided the wire needed to move up about an eighth inch . So I drilled a little hole just above the cable and tried to wiggle the bit up and down a tad-tad too much,pop went the cable!! It,s the last rib out just before the tip. Can some type of clamp connector fix this ?
